摘要: 基本数据结构的比较 基本数据结构 1. 列表(List) 元素有放入顺序,元素可重复。 数组实现(ArrayList类) JDK8源码中,初始长度是10,每次数组扩展都增加1/2左右。即: int hash = key.hashCode(); int index = (hash & 0x7FFFFF 阅读全文
posted @ 2017-07-27 21:40 何必等明天 阅读(341) 评论(0) 推荐(0) 编辑
摘要: 探索equals()和hashCode()方法 在根类Object中,实现了equals()和hashCode()这两个方法,默认: equals()是对两个对象的地址值进行的比较(即比较引用是否相同),用==实现。 hashCode():计算出对象实例的哈希码。根类Object的hashCode( 阅读全文
posted @ 2017-07-27 21:17 何必等明天 阅读(436) 评论(0) 推荐(0) 编辑